So it's been a great success story.

And why?

First of all, because Adam Smith's been in permanent

residence in Hong Kong over the two decades when our

economy has quadrupled in its strength and size. We have been a community which has practiced market economics

year-in and year-out with considerable zest and skill.

Secondly, we're at the center of the fastest-

growing region in the world, where hundreds of millions of

people are, in Churchill's phrase, moving ahead to better

pastures and brighter days, and not only at the center of

the Asia-Pacific region but also at the gateway of China,

where the Chinese economy has been opening up over the

last years with tremendous success. 70 percent of the

investment that goes into China goes through Hong Kong.

80 percent of the investment that goes in to Guandong goes

in through Hong Kong.

The third reason

the third reason for our

success is that we have combined Chinese

entrepreneurialism with the rule of law, and the rule of

law isn't, as you know, just a matter of judges in wigs

sitting in courts. The rule of law is about the

relationship, as well, between a free press, a credible

legislature, and an independent court system.

All those things are keys to Hong Kong's

prosperity, because, just as our prosperity has sustained

our way of life, So it's equally true that our way of life

has helped to sustain our prosperity.
